Astroglial reactive gliosis in the rat hippocampus at 8 weeks after pilocarpine‐induced status epilepticus. GFAP (red) positive reactive astrocytes in the stratum lacunosum‐moleculare show strong GS (green) immunoreactivity, while GFAP‐positive astrocytes show no GS immunoreactivity in the molecular layer of the dentate gyrus. Blue is DAPI counterstaining. J. Comp. Neurol. 511:581–598, 2008. © 2008 Wiley‐Liss, Inc.
